为什么写完vue页面是空的

不及物动词 其他 154

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    写完Vue页面后出现空白的情况,可能有以下几个原因:

    1. 缺少挂载点:Vue应用需要将组件挂载到具体的DOM元素上才能显示,如果忘记在HTML中指定挂载点,页面就会是空白的。

    解决方法:确保在HTML中指定了正确的挂载点,例如使用<div id="app"></div>作为挂载点,然后在Vue实例中指定el: '#app'

    1. 组件未正确定义或引用:如果在组件定义或引用上出现问题,页面可能无法正确渲染。

    解决方法:确保所有组件都被正确引用,组件定义的名称和引用时的名称一致,引入的路径正确。

    1. 数据未成功获取或渲染:如果数据获取或渲染过程出现错误,页面可能无法显示内容。

    解决方法:检查数据获取和渲染的相关代码,确保数据能够正确获取并绑定到相应的组件上。

    1. 语法错误或逻辑错误:如果在Vue代码中存在语法错误或逻辑错误,可能会导致页面无法正常显示。

    解决方法:检查Vue代码,特别是模板语法、计算属性、方法等部分,确保没有错误。可以使用浏览器的开发者工具查看控制台是否有报错信息,帮助定位问题。

    1. 其他错误原因:还有一些其他可能的错误原因,比如浏览器缓存问题、网络请求失败等。

    解决方法:清除浏览器缓存、检查网络连接,可以尝试在其他浏览器或设备上运行代码,查看是否仍然出现空白页面。

    总结:写完Vue页面后出现空白的情况,可能是因为缺少挂载点、组件引用或定义错误、数据获取或渲染问题、语法或逻辑错误等原因。通过排查以上可能的问题,可以解决空白页面的情况。如果问题仍然存在,建议逐步调试和排查,寻找具体的错误原因。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论
    1. 语法错误:在编写Vue页面时,可能会出现语法错误,例如拼写错误、缺少符号或括号不匹配等。这会导致页面无法正确渲染,最终显示为空白页面。

    2. 数据绑定问题:Vue是一个数据驱动的框架,页面的内容通常是通过数据绑定来展示的。如果在页面中没有正确地绑定数据或绑定了错误的数据,那么页面可能显示为空白。

    3. 组件引入问题:Vue可以将页面划分为多个组件,不同的组件之间可以相互嵌套。如果在编写Vue页面时,没有正确地引入组件或组件没有被正确地渲染,也会导致页面显示为空白。

    4. 缺少渲染元素:在编写Vue页面时,需要在HTML模板中添加Vue的根元素,该元素会被Vue实例所管理和渲染。如果页面缺少这样的根元素,那么页面将无法正常渲染,最终显示为空白。

    5. 数据请求问题:Vue常用于与后端接口进行数据交互。如果在页面中没有正确地发送请求或处理返回的数据,那么页面可能无法正常显示数据,最终显示为空白。

    总结:写完Vue页面为空的原因可能包括语法错误、数据绑定问题、组件引入问题、缺少渲染元素以及数据请求问题。检查以上可能问题,可以排除错误,并确保页面能够正常渲染和显示数据。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在开发过程中,编写vue页面时页面内容为空可能是由以下几个原因引起的:

    1. 未正确引入Vue框架:在Vue开发中,首先需要确保正确引入Vue框架。可以通过在HTML文件中引入Vue.js文件来实现。例如,可以在HTML文件中加入以下代码:
    <script src="https://cdn.jsdelivr.net/npm/vue"></script>
    
    1. 错误的语法或拼写错误:在编写Vue页面时,需要注意Vue的语法和拼写。Vue的标签和指令应该按照正确的形式进行编写。例如,Vue的模版语法使用双花括号{{ }}来插入表达式,如果拼写错误,可能导致页面内容为空。

    2. 数据绑定问题:Vue的核心是数据驱动,页面的内容会随着数据的变化而更新。如果在编写页面时没有正确的进行数据绑定,可能导致页面内容为空。需要确保在Vue的实例中正确定义和初始化要绑定的数据,并在页面中使用合适的指令将数据与页面元素进行绑定。

    3. 生命周期问题:Vue组件有不同的生命周期钩子函数,在这些函数中可以进行一些特定的操作,例如在created钩子函数中进行数据的初始化。如果在编写页面时没有正确实现对应的生命周期钩子函数,可能导致页面内容为空。

    4. 组件使用问题:如果页面中使用了自定义组件,可能需要确保正确引入并注册这些组件。在使用组件时,需要遵循组件的使用方式和参数传递方式。如果组件的使用出现问题,可能导致页面内容为空。

    综上所述,写完Vue页面后内容为空可能是由框架引入问题、语法或拼写错误、数据绑定问题、生命周期问题或组件使用问题等原因导致的。在编写页面时,需要注意以上几个方面,确保正确编写和使用Vue的相关语法和特性,以及合理使用各种功能和指令。如果问题仍无法解决,可以结合具体的错误提示进行进一步调试和排查。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部